Anyone else having a problem with SAMs since the June patch? Some of the SAMs, instead of guiding on a target, appear to be flying a ballistic trajectory after launch until the missile hits the ground or the Missile Duration time ends. Primarily I see this happening with stock TW SAMs. I have seen it occur with the SA-N-1, SA-N-3, SA-N-4, RIM-7H, and RIM-66B so far. I am going to continue testing but I would like to know if anyone can confirm my observations.

I do not know I anyone else has noticed this but I just found an error in the stock Krivak II's data.ini file. The ship's Gun1 and Gun2 are listed as "GunTypeName=76MM_AK100". It should be the "100MM_AK100". Due the this error the Krivak II class has no working guns. -

I decided to start this thread as a result of some testing thatI did after reading a post by combatace member colmac (Click here to read) aboutthe ineffectiveness of gun based CIWS on a community made ship, in this case WhiteBoySamurai’s resent Kirovpack. In my testing I noticed something odd. On a number of thirdparty ships the CIWS often fire’s just one or two burst at the first inboundASM missile and/or salvo and then refused to engage any coming in following it.In comparison on TW ships like the “OHPerry_82” and the “Spruance_82” this didnot happen. On those ships their CIWS guns continued to engage missile until theyhad no more targets or were overwhelmed. I have done some further testing and have managed to get theCIWS well on some ships. On others it is still only partly effective, engagingand then stopping and doing nothing as more missile are inbound. I think theburst length of the CIWS in relation to the rate of fire of the gun its mounts mightbe an important part of the solution but there is more to it than that.
